Report: TFC short Mavinga, Van der Wiel to open CCL
Toronto Sun Sun reporter Kurt Larson reports that Toronto FC will be missing a pair of defenders when they open CONCACAF Champions League Round of 16 play at Colorado on Tuesday, as Chris Mavinga and Gregory van der Wiel have been left back at home to recover from injuries. READ MORE

Lions' Dwyer to miss opening day?
Pro Soccer USA reports that Orlando City striker Dom Dwyer is expected to miss 2-4 weeks after suffering a quad strain in last week's friendly against Philadelphia. The Lions will kick off the new season – with or without him – when D.C. United come to town on March 3. READ MORE
Transfer talk: Horta, Sane, Freitas, Mason
ESPN is reporting that LAFC's persistent chase for Benfica midfielder Andre Horta could soon pay off. The Portugal youth international has notched a goal and six assists in 18 games this season while on loan to Braga. READ MORE
According to Pro Soccer USA, Orlando City are on the verge of signing Werder Bremen center back Lamine Sane. The 30-year-old has 25 Senegal caps to his credit. READ MORE
Reports out of Minnesota indicate that the Loons are trying to acquire Fluminense midfielder Marlon Freitas. The 22-year-old has previous experience in America, having played a NASL season on loan with Fort Lauderdale in 2015 READ MORE
Reports on both sides of the Atlantic suggest that Colorado are closing on a deal to land Wolverhampton forward Joe Mason. The former Ireland Under-21 international has 42 career Championship goals, but has become a bit player with the league-leading Wolves this term. READ MORE
